Can I Buy My Home Back After A Short Sale?

Previously I would have told you “No way!”  I would have lamented about how the bank will gladly sell your home to someone else but they do not want you anywhere near the home any longer.  However, there is a new program being offered through utilizing NSP funds (Neigbhorhood Stabilization Program) that has one company buying home owners homes through a short sale and giving them an opportunity to buy the home back within 4 years.   There’s a lot of programs that claim that to do this and many of them are illegal, so here’s how you can do your due diligence.
